The queens of Westerberg High have returned, and they’re making a scene once again at New World Stages.

In a brand-new clip released from the Off-Broadway revival of Heathers the Musical, McKenzie Kurtz, Olivia Elease Hardy and Elizabeth Teeter are taking centre stage in the number Candy Store – and it’s every bit as ferocious as we remember.

This extended revival run will keep the drama going all the way through to 25 January 2026.

It’s a homecoming of sorts – the cult musical is back at the same venue that hosted its original New York production in 2014.

Originally adapted from the 1988 teen dark comedy, Heathers follows Veronica Sawyer as she climbs the social ladder at Westerberg High after befriending the school’s most dangerous clique: the Heathers.

But things take a twisted turn when she meets J.D., the mysterious new student with an even darker agenda.

Lorna Courtney leads as Veronica, joined by Casey Likes as J.D., with Kurtz, Hardy, and Teeter stepping into the iconic roles of Heather Chandler, Heather Duke, and Heather McNamara.

The cast also features Kerry Butler playing a double role as Ms. Fleming and Veronica’s mum.
